As for the accommodation itself, there’s not much to complain about except for the poorly designed bathroom, where the shower is only separated by a curtain, which is basically useless – water was everywhere no matter how hard we tried. The room was nicely cleaned every day, and during the week-long stay, the towels were changed, so no real complaints there. The food was good, quite a large selection, so everyone could find something they liked. The choice of drinks was limited, but I wasn’t expecting a wide variety, so I was satisfied. What I found strange was the charge for the fitness area – 7 € for four cardio machines crammed into a small room. I didn’t see anyone use it during the entire stay. The hotel had quite a few rules in my opinion – swimming in the pool was allowed from 8 AM to 8 PM, there was a dress code for dinner (which is understandable for some), you weren’t supposed to bring drinks from the bar to the dining table, and you couldn’t go for food in your swimsuit. ‼️ If you're going on a trip, you can request a snack box at the reception, but beware – YOU CANNOT go for breakfast, which honestly disappointed me. When we opened the small box during our trip, it contained a dry toast, ham, cheese, and a small apple. If you’ve paid for all-inclusive, you don’t expect to be limited in having breakfast, and essentially lunch too, when you're on a full-day excursion. Not to mention, with all-inclusive, you’re entitled to five meals (breakfast, morning snack, lunch, afternoon snack, and dinner). ‼️ The beaches were disappointing, but that’s not the hotel’s fault. If you don’t have high expectations and just want to relax, I’d recommend this hotel. In my view, it’s aimed at adults – which is exactly what we were looking for. :) If you want to go on a trip, travel agencies offer excursions, or you can rent a car. Honestly, if we hadn’t rented a car, I would have been disappointed by the surroundings, but that’s purely a subjective opinion.
Unfortunately, I cannot recommend this accommodation, as it was, without a doubt, the most unpleasant experience I've had so far. Although the hotel claims to be 4 stars, the level of service and the conditions provided are far below expectations, barely qualifying for 3 stars. For example, the private parking is not properly arranged – just an unmaintained area with trees, where cars with low ground clearance risk damage. The bathroom was probably the smallest I’ve ever seen, approximately 1 square meter. The shower was simply a curtain that inevitably stuck to you, and the water spread all over the bathroom, creating a puddle. The breakfast was another major disappointment – an extremely limited, repetitive selection of low-quality items, consisting of the cheapest products. In the afternoon, the only option for a shower was cold water, and the reception told us there was a technical issue – but this seemed more like an excuse. Towels are changed only every three days, unless you specifically request otherwise. Additionally, the air conditioning works very slowly, taking a long time to cool the room. The hotel advertises certain events, such as "Greek night - live music", but unfortunately, none were organized during our stay. Moreover, our attempts to contact the hotel by email prior to arrival went unanswered. Access to the fitness room comes at an extra charge (7 euros/day), although the room is just a hallway with five improvised machines. Even weighing your luggage upon departure requires a fee of 1 euro. After check-out, if your flight is not in the morning, the only waiting area is a room without air conditioning. In addition, the Wi-Fi connection did not work at all during our stay, and the phone signal was very weak in the rooms. In conclusion, our experience was disappointing, and unfortunately, we cannot recommend this hotel.
